Drain Tile Installation in Birmingham, AL
Drain tile installation is a drainage solution designed to help manage excess water around a property’s foundation, basement, or landscape. This service involves installing perforated pipes within gravel trenches to redirect water away from critical areas, reducing the risk of flooding, foundation damage, or moisture buildup. Drain tile systems are commonly requested for projects such as basement waterproofing, yard drainage improvements, or managing water flow on sloped terrains, helping property owners maintain a dry and stable environment around their homes.
Before requesting drain tile installation, property owners often want to understand the scope of the project, including the placement of the pipes, the type of materials used, and how the system integrates with existing drainage features. It’s also helpful to consider the property’s grading and water flow patterns, as these factors influence the most effective installation approach. Proper planning ensures the system effectively channels water away from the foundation or problem areas, providing long-term protection and peace of mind.

Drain Tile Installation Questions
What is drain tile installation? Drain tile installation involves placing perforated pipes underground to redirect excess water away from a property’s foundation and prevent water buildup.
Why is drain tile installation important? Proper drain tile helps protect a property from water damage, basement flooding, and foundation issues caused by excessive moisture.
What types of properties typically need drain tile services? Drain tile is commonly used in homes with poor drainage, basements prone to flooding, or properties with high water tables.
How does drain tile installation work? The process includes excavating around the foundation, laying perforated pipes, and covering them with gravel to facilitate effective water drainage.
